Product Overview
Our Professional Sports Turf is engineered for elite‑level football, hockey, and multi‑sport competitions. The carpet features 100% PE monofilament fibers (straight or hybrid with curly for reduced abrasion) tufted into a composite mesh backing with PU or hot‑melt coating. Pile height 50‑60mm, DTEX 12000‑14000, and stitch density ≥25200 per m² ensure outstanding resilience and wear resistance. The filled system uses quartz sand and SBR/EPDM rubber infill to achieve FIFA‑mandated shock absorption (55‑70%) and vertical deformation (4‑11mm). All materials comply with REACH and RoHS. | Parameter | Value | FIFA Requirement |
|---|---|---|
| Pile height | 50‑60 mm | 40‑65 mm |
| DTEX | 12000‑14000 | ≥8800 |
| Density (stitches/m²) | ≥25200 | ≥21000 |
| Fiber material | PE monofilament | — |
| Backing | Composite mesh + PU/hot‑melt | — |
| Infill system | Sand + SBR/EPDM (6‑8 kg/m² sand + 5‑6 kg/m² rubber) | — |
| Shock absorption | 55‑70% | 55‑70% |
| Vertical deformation | 4‑11 mm | 4‑11 mm |
| UV resistance (QUV 5000h) | Color fastness ≥4 | — |
| Service life | 10‑12 years | — |

| Sport | Pile height | DTEX | Density | Infill type |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Football (11v11) | 50‑60 mm | ≥12000 | ≥25200 | SBR or EPDM |
| Hockey | 45‑55 mm | ≥11000 | ≥24000 | Sand‑only (less rubber) |
| Rugby | 55‑65 mm | ≥13000 | ≥22000 | EPDM (softer) |
| Multi‑sport | 50‑55 mm | ≥12000 | ≥24000 | SBR/EPDM mixed |

Q: Is this turf FIFA certified?
→ We supply materials that meet FIFA Quality Pro requirements. Full pitch certification involves field testing; we provide lab test reports to support your application.
Q: What infill is best for high‑traffic football?
→ SBR rubber is cost‑effective; EPDM offers better UV resistance and longer life. For high‑sun regions, EPDM is recommended.
